Use the actual process image instead of module filename to dedup session (#19415)

Apparently, `GetModuleFileNameW` returns exactly the path (or prefix, in
case of a DLL) passed to `CreateProcess` casing and all. Since we were
using it to generate the uniquing hash for Portable and Unpackaged
instances, this meant that `C:\Terminal\wt` and `C:\TeRmInAl\wt` were
considered different instances. Whoops.

Using `QueryFullProcessImageNameW` instead results in canonicalization.
Maybe the kernel does it. I don't know. What I do know is that it works
more correctly.

(`Query...` goes through the kernel, while `GetModule...` goes through
the loader. Interesting!)
